SWiSH Forum
Forum użytkowników programów SWiSH

SWiSH Max - zmienne raz jeszcze

kosecki - Czw 06 Kwi, 2006 14:18
Temat postu: zmienne raz jeszcze
Mam taki problem, zrobilem formularz w ktorym sa sprite ktory imituja pola checkbox,

maja taki kod:

on (press) {
prod_f = "tak";
}

pozniej jest inny guzik wyslij:

on (press) {
prod = prod_f;
}

ale zmienna prod_f jest nie widoczna, jak zrobic zeby byla widoczna. czytalem ze zmienne we flashu sa globalne, ale tu to nie jest prawda.

edit: po zrobieniu nas kod do przycisku wyslij:

onLoad() {
prodVar="dupa";
typVar="";
trace(prodVar);
}

on (release) {
poV = prodVar;
}

dalej jest:
Cannot find variable or function 'prodVar' in statement:

roland - Czw 06 Kwi, 2006 15:21

O ile dobrze zrozumiałem, to chcesz się odwołać do zminnej znajdującej się wewnątrz duszka, będąc w animacji głównej. Zastosuj:
nazwa_duszka.nazwa_zmiennej

kosecki - Czw 06 Kwi, 2006 17:54

juz doszedlem. poprostu zapis robilem do zmiennej _root.zmienna i tak samo odczyt, chyba najlatwiej i nie jest wrazliwe na zmiany nazw "duszkow" :)

Powered by phpBB modified by Przemo © 2003 phpBB Group